With this communication object, it is possible to disable the fault messages (lamp or ballast fault) of the DLR/S. If the fault
messages are disabled, the DLR/S will continue to undertake fault message examination regarding lamp and ballast faults.
During the inhibit, the faults are evaluated but not sent on the KNX. The values of the communication objects are also not
updated.
The latent time of the system can be minimized at low KNX load when the fault messages are inhibited.
When all fault messages are enabled, the malfunctions will be sent in accordance with their parameterization. If a fault still
exists after enabling of the fault message, this fault is recorded and the information is sent on the KNX in accordance with
the parameterization.

This communication object is always enabled.
Using this communication object, you indicate if the system state does not correspond with the state in the DALI Light
Controller, i.e., there are differences between the group and scene assignments stored in the DLR/S when compared to the
information stored in the DALI devices. This can, for example, be the case if exchanged or pre-programmed DALI devices
with group assignments are installed on the DLR/S.

Note
This function can, for example, be useful for systems with emergency lighting applications for daily checking
of the lamps of the DALI devices by the DALI control line, and thus disconnect them from the DALI master
(DLR/S). In this case, the DLR/S detects the loss of the DALI device and sends a ballast fault, even though
this is a normal operating state. Should the fault message be disabled before separation from the DALI
control line, no fault is reported by the DLR/S. Operation can continue as normal. After checking the lighting
equipment, normal monitoring can be reactivated via the fault message communication object Disabel send.
of fault message.
